Consider the following data for a hypothetical economy that manufactures engines (the only intermediate good), motorcycles and cars.
Year Commodity Price Quantity
2009 Engines $2 150
2009 Cars $15 100
2009 Motorcycles $10 50
2010 Engines $6 154
2010 Cars $50 99
2010 Motorcycles $9 55
2011 Engines $10 160
2011 Cars $90 90
2011 Motorcycles $8 70
Calculate a real GDP index for each year using the chain-weighted method with real GDP in 2009 equal to 1.
